cnc编程g代码代表什么意思
-
CNC编程G代码是机器人或机床上使用的一种编程语言,用于控制机器的运动和操作。G代码是由一系列字母和数字组成的命令,每个命令都代表特定的功能或操作。下面将详细介绍G代码的含义和作用。
G代码的字母代表了不同的功能,常见的字母包括:
- G:表示“几何”或“全局”功能,用于控制机器的运动方式,如直线插补、圆弧插补、坐标系选择等。
- M:表示“杂项”功能,用于控制机器的其他操作,如启动/停止主轴、冷却液开关、夹具控制等。
- T:表示工具选择,用于选择机器上的刀具或其他工具。
- S:表示主轴速度,用于控制主轴的转速。
- F:表示进给速度,用于控制工件和刀具之间的相对运动速度。
除了字母,G代码还包括数字,用于指定具体的数值参数。例如,G01表示直线插补,G02表示顺时针圆弧插补,G03表示逆时针圆弧插补,G90表示绝对坐标系,G91表示增量坐标系,M03表示启动主轴等等。
通过编写G代码程序,操作人员可以控制机器按照预定的路径和速度进行加工操作。在编程过程中,需要考虑工件的尺寸、形状、加工方式以及机器的性能等因素,以确保程序的准确性和安全性。
总之,CNC编程G代码是控制机器运动和操作的一种语言,通过编写G代码程序,可以实现机器的自动化加工和生产。掌握G代码的含义和使用方法对于操作人员来说非常重要,它是实现精密加工和提高生产效率的关键之一。
1年前 -
CNC编程G代码代表了一种用于控制计算机数控机床的指令语言。G代码是一种数字化的指令集,它告诉机床如何进行切削、定位、进给和加工等操作。G代码是由字母G和后面的数字组成,每个代码都代表着特定的机床操作。
以下是关于CNC编程G代码的几个重要点:
-
G代码的作用:G代码告诉机床如何进行各种操作,包括定位、切削速度、进给速度、切削方式、刀具半径补偿等。通过编写G代码,操作者可以将设计好的零件图纸转化为机床可以理解和执行的指令。
-
G代码的格式:G代码通常由字母G和后面的数字组成,例如G01、G02、G03等。字母G表示“几何(Geometry)”,后面的数字表示不同的操作。每个G代码都有特定的功能,如G01表示直线插补、G02表示圆弧插补、G03表示逆时针圆弧插补等。
-
G代码的组合:G代码可以按照需要组合使用,以实现复杂的操作。例如,可以使用G01进行直线插补,然后使用G02进行圆弧插补,从而实现复杂的轮廓加工。
-
G代码的参数:除了字母G和后面的数字,G代码还可以包含一些参数,如切削速度、进给速度、切削深度等。这些参数可以根据具体的加工需求进行调整,以达到理想的加工效果。
-
G代码的生成和编辑:G代码可以通过计算机辅助编程软件(CAM软件)生成,也可以手动编写和编辑。编写G代码需要对机床和加工工艺有一定的了解,以确保生成的代码正确、安全和高效。
总之,CNC编程G代码是一种用于控制数控机床的指令语言,它告诉机床如何进行切削、定位、进给和加工等操作。对于从事数控加工的操作者来说,掌握和理解G代码是非常重要的。
1年前 -
-
G代码是一种数控编程语言,用于控制数控机床进行加工操作。G代码通常由字母G和其后的数字组成,表示不同的功能和操作。G代码的作用是告诉数控机床如何进行刀具移动、切削速度、进给速度等操作。下面是一些常见的G代码及其含义:
-
G00:快速定位。用于将刀具快速移动到指定位置,不进行切削。
-
G01:直线插补。用于将刀具沿直线路径进行切削。
-
G02和G03:圆弧插补。用于将刀具沿圆弧路径进行切削,G02表示顺时针方向,G03表示逆时针方向。
-
G04:暂停。用于在加工过程中暂停一段时间。
-
G17、G18和G19:平面选择。G17表示选择XY平面,G18表示选择XZ平面,G19表示选择YZ平面。
-
G20和G21:单位选择。G20表示英制单位(英寸),G21表示公制单位(毫米)。
-
G40、G41和G42:刀具半径补偿。G40表示取消刀具半径补偿,G41表示左刀具半径补偿,G42表示右刀具半径补偿。
-
G54到G59:工件坐标系选择。用于选择不同的工件坐标系,方便进行坐标变换。
-
G80:取消模态。用于取消之前设置的模态指令。
-
G90和G91:进给模式选择。G90表示绝对进给,G91表示增量进给。
除了以上这些常见的G代码,还有很多其他的G代码,用于实现不同的功能和操作。编写G代码需要根据具体的加工要求和数控机床的功能来选择和组合使用。在编程过程中,还需要考虑刀具尺寸、切削速度、进给速度等参数,以确保加工质量和效率。
1年前 -